About the role
Astronomers spend 50% of their time providing functional support to the ESA-NASA partnered missions at STScI, and 50% of their time on personal research. The successful candidates are expected to maintain an active program of research in astronomy, in addition to carrying out functional tasks related to the HST mission support within STScI for ESA.
The ESA/AURA astronomers generally provide functional support to all major aspects of science operations. Functional duties usually encompass all activities associated with support of the suite of active instruments currently on board HST, including but not limited to:
- Support of the calibration, data reduction, and analysis of HST data
- On-orbit performance verification and monitoring of the health of the scientific instruments
- Direct support to the user community during the preparation, implementation, and execution of the observing programs
- Documentation
Efforts are made to suitably match the background and experience of qualified candidates to current mission needs.

Work Environment
STScI occupies multiple sites surrounding the campus of the Johns Hopkins University (JHU) in Baltimore, MD. It maintains close connections with the JHU Physics and Astronomy Department and is a partner in both the Pan-STARRS and LSST consortia. The research environment engages, stimulates, and supports an international research staff with over 100 members. Active research areas span a wide range of topics and include collaborations with postdoctoral researchers, research instrument analysts, JHU graduate students, and researchers from other institutions.
Researchers lead the organization of annual workshops and larger-scale meetings and participate in the activities of the office of public outreach.
